A3213/4 Micropower Ultrasensitive Hall Effect Switches, Allegro Microsystems


The Allegro Microsystems A3213/4 ultra-sensitive, pole independent Hall-effect switches with a latched digital output are aimed at use in battery-operated, portable equipment. Their 2.4 V to 5.5 V operation and a unique clocking scheme reduces the average operating power use. The A3213 to 825 μW and the A3214 to 14 μW (typical, at 2.75 V).

Either a north or south pole turns on the output.

They include a Hall-voltage generator, small-signal amplifier, chopper stabilisation, a latch, and a MOSFET output.

AEC-Q100 automotive qualified

Micropower operation

Superior temperature stability

Low switchpoint drift

Insensitive to physical stress

High ESD protection
